About The Avenue
The Avenue is a one-bedroom mid-terrace house in Hull (HU1 1PA). It has a recorded floor area of 56 m² (around 603 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. At 56 m² this is the largest unit on EPC record across The Avenue (25–56 m²). The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 10 units on file. Period features are noted in the property record. The latest certificate (July 2021) shows a D (score 55),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since May 2011.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or and lighting went from Poor to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Good to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77).
Most recent transfer: November 2021 at £95,000.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. At 56 m² it's 15.5% larger than the typical home in the postcode (49 m² median across 36 EPCs). Across 2015–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 13.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£107,000 is 12.6%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£158/sq ft) was about 62.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
